The bill for CWFC 70 in Dublin this weekend has undergone a late change, with the bout between Jake Bostwick and Philip Mulpeter being removed from the card ahead of this afternoon’s weigh-ins.
The fight has been scrapped due to Bostwick being unable to make the 171lbs limit for his welterweight clash with the Irishman at The Helix tomorrow night.
Bostwick arrived at the CWFC hotel in Dublin yesterday (Thursday) morning, weighing 194lbs. The 24-year Englishman tipped the scales at 182lbs at 11.05am this morning but was unable to cut any further.
Subsequently, Philip Mulpeter and his camp have understandably opted not to compete under these circumstances, so the fight has unfortunately been cancelled.
New opponents were considered for both fighters – Mulpeter at welterweight, Bostwick at middleweight – but officials were unable to source suitable replacements who could be passed fit to compete by SAFE MMA on such short notice.
“This is obviously a very unfortunate situation,” said Cage Warriors CEO Graham Boylan. “It’s disappointing for everyone, particularly Philip Mulpeter, but also for the Cage Warriors fans who have been looking forward to this fight for a long time.
“We reacted to the situation as well as we could. We thought about new options for Philip and we even had Henry Fadipe interested in stepping in to face Jake, but neither has worked out so both guys are now without fights.
“Henry was in a five-round title fight just over a week ago in South Africa, and Jake isn’t in great shape physically either right now due to the weight-cut, so there’s no way we could give a fight like that the green light on the grounds of safety.
“It’s a blow to lose one of the most highly-anticipated fights on the card, but CWFC 70 is still stacked from top to bottom, so we’re looking forward to another exciting Dublin event tomorrow night.”
Mulpeter was on weight at 169.6lbs shortly after 1pm, and will therefore receive his full fight purse. Bostwick will not receive a purse.
The bantamweight clash between Dean Garnett and Martin Sheridan has now been moved up to the main card to fill the vacancy.
